How To Choose The Best Baggy High Waisted Jeans

Baggy high-waisted jeans require a denim matrix that combines a high rise (10.5 to 12 inches) with a leg opening wide enough to create the drape effect without swallowing your frame. The most common failure is a waistband that gaps because the fabric lacks recovery — the ability to snap back after stretching. Below are the three non-negotiable factors that separate a great pair from a regretful return.

Stretch Content and Fabric Weight

Denim labeled as stretchy can mean anything from 1% elastane to a cotton-poly-spandex blend. For baggy jeans, a fabric weight between 8 and 10 ounces per square yard paired with 2–3% elastane gives you the structured drape that holds shape while allowing hip and thigh movement. Anything above 11 ounces becomes too rigid for a wide-leg drape; anything below 7 ounces feels flimsy and loses the waist fit within three wears.

Rise Height vs. Torso Length

A 10.5-inch rise sits at the natural waist for most women, but if you have a shorter torso, a 12-inch rise can hit above the belly button and create bulk. The ideal rise lets the waistband rest at your narrowest point without needing to be cinched painfully tight. Brands with adjustable side tabs or internal buttons offer a margin of error for this measurement.

Inseam and Leg Opening Width

Baggy jeans rely on the leg opening width for their signature silhouette. A hem circumference of 18 to 22 inches creates the relaxed Y2K or barrel shape. For inseam, 27 to 28 inches works for petite frames, while 30 to 32 inches suits average to tall heights. Going too long results in pooling at the ankle that distorts the baggy line, while too short cuts off the flare prematurely.

FAQ

What denim weight is best for baggy high waisted jeans that don’t sag?
A fabric weight between 8 and 10 ounces per square yard with 2–3% elastane provides the ideal structure for baggy jeans. Lighter fabric folds and wrinkles, while heavier fabric resists draping and can look stiff.
How do I fix the back waist gap on high waisted baggy jeans?
Look for jeans with adjustable side tabs, internal cinch buttons, or a built-in elastic panel at the back waistband. Levi’s Cinch Barrel uses side tabs, while Arach&Cloz uses side adjusters — both reduce the gap without compromising the front silhouette.
